What is a Ministry Partner Training Event?

Our ministry partner training is aimed at development professionals working for LCMS organizations and congregations who are looking to increase their knowledge of gift planning and integrate planned giving into their overall development programs. 

Who should attend?

While Ministry Partner Training is open to anyone from an LCMS ministry, it is aimed specifically at those who are “donor-facing,” that is, in professional development staff roles or in institutional leadership at our larger LCMS ministries, RSOs, Universities/Seminaries, and K-12 Schools. Participants might include but are not limited to: 

  • Larger RSO Development/Advancement officers 
  • RSO Development/Advancement administrators & leadership 
  • Large congregation/ministry board members and leadership 
  • University/seminary Development/Advancement officers 
  • University/seminary board members and leadership 
  • K-12 Principals & Development/Advancement staff 

What will be covered in the training?

Course content focuses on best practices for opening conversations about gift planning, surfacing potential planned gifts, developing awareness of present day and future planned gift options, implementing strategies for stewarding planned gifts, and understanding how the LCMS Foundation can assist ministries in the gift planning process. 

What happens after the training?

After the training workshop, Ministry Partners will receive materials to begin introducing gift planning into their donor conversations. They will also receive ongoing coaching support from the Foundation and their local gift planning counselor, and they will be invited to attend regular webinars or other online gatherings to receive updates and further education.
